Precision Hormone Replacement the Foundational Recalibration

Testosterone Replacement Therapy (TRT) serves as the primary tool for restoring the fundamental masculine engine. This process is far beyond a simple injection; it involves meticulous titration to maintain steady-state physiological levels, often using compounds like Testosterone Cypionate or Enanthate, alongside co-factors to manage estrogen metabolism and preserve fertility, such as HCG or an aromatase inhibitor, when clinically indicated.

The objective is to sustain peak-level endocrine signaling, ensuring the androgen receptors receive the high-fidelity message required for muscle synthesis, fat oxidation, and neural activation.

For women, a similarly precise approach to Estrogen, Progesterone, and DHEA replacement corrects the metabolic and cognitive deficits that often accompany peri- and post-menopause, leading to a profound restoration of vitality and structural resilience.

  1. Advanced Biomarker Screening ∞ Establish a comprehensive baseline (Free/Total Testosterone, SHBG, Estradiol, PSA, CBC, Lipids, Thyroid Panel).
  2. Protocol Design ∞ Select the appropriate compound and delivery method (injection, cream, pellet) based on pharmacokinetics and patient preference.
  3. Dose Titration ∞ Adjust dosage incrementally over weeks, guided by follow-up labs, to achieve a sustained optimal-range total-to-free hormone ratio.
  4. Co-Factor Management ∞ Implement agents to manage downstream effects and maintain the integrity of the entire HPG axis.

Peptide Science the Cellular Instruction Set

Peptides are the body’s native signaling molecules, offering a method to communicate with specific cell types with surgical precision. They are not blunt instruments; they are targeted messengers. Growth Hormone Secretagogues (GHS) like Ipamorelin and CJC-1295 (without DAC) instruct the pituitary gland to release a more pulsatile, physiological burst of growth hormone. This mechanism promotes deep, restorative sleep, accelerates cellular repair, and optimizes body composition through enhanced fat burning and collagen synthesis.

Growth Hormone Releasing Peptides (GHRPs) have been shown in trials to increase serum IGF-1 levels by up to 50-70% when administered correctly, driving superior recovery and tissue repair mechanisms.

Other classes of peptides target specific functions ∞ Thymosin Beta 4 (TB-500) for tissue regeneration and injury repair, or Melanotan II for tanning and, importantly, its well-documented effects on central nervous system-mediated sexual arousal and function. growth hormone

Meaning ∞ Growth Hormone (GH), also known as somatotropin, is a single-chain polypeptide hormone secreted by the anterior pituitary gland, playing a central role in regulating growth, body composition, and systemic metabolism.

total testosterone

Meaning ∞ Total testosterone is the quantitative clinical measurement of all testosterone molecules circulating in the bloodstream, encompassing both the fraction that is tightly bound to sex hormone-binding globulin (SHBG) and the fractions that are weakly bound to albumin or circulating freely.

hpg axis

Meaning ∞ The HPG Axis, short for Hypothalamic-Pituitary-Gonadal Axis, is the master regulatory system controlling reproductive and sexual development and function in both males and females.

growth hormone secretagogues

Meaning ∞ Growth Hormone Secretagogues (GHSs) are a category of compounds that stimulate the release of endogenous Growth Hormone (GH) from the anterior pituitary gland through specific mechanisms.
